  • Descrição: In a recent paper we solved the Bernstein problem in the nonregular nonexceptional case for the type (3,2). The aim of this paper it is to describe explicitly all simplicial stochastic nonexceptional nonregular nonnuclear Bernstein algebras of type (n−2,2). According to the Lyubich conjecture every nuclear Bernstein algebra with stochastic realization is regular. Consequently, this paper would completely solve the Bernstein problem for the type (n−2,2) if the Lyubich conjecture is proved to be true.
